WebFeb 20, 2024 · What not to do. If you are choosing to help a friend, here are a few things to avoid: 1. Do not assume. Ask. Even if you've been through a breakup before, everyone likes to be cared for in different ways. You may think you know what your friend wants during this vulnerable time, but you might be wrong. WebJan 17, 2024 · Schedule plans with friends. "In the early days after a break-up, you're likely not to feel great, so try to distract yourself as much as possible," says Lester. "Make plans with friends so you don't have time to wallow." Book a dinner date with your best friend—and if it turns into an hours-long hang, all the better.
